Transaction 64fb645387d030bd74edc55ba167429902ffc38efde52ca844d7bc4d16565f92

1 Input
2 Outputs
  • 64fb645387d030bd74edc55ba167429902ffc38efde52ca844d7bc4d16565f92:0
  • value  2000000
    address  3G6yLf3XCTixX25rqxxoUt5Pw6sEiKsyu4
  • 64fb645387d030bd74edc55ba167429902ffc38efde52ca844d7bc4d16565f92:1
  • value  100807730
    address  12GbGQMzisq9Ld6HEXdTh6HH5Euvk6xPwr